I brought my Mom and husband to the Casino on May 10th(Mother's day) We were staying at a hotel in Windsor and not at the casino's hotel but we used the Valet because my husband is an amputee in a wheelchair and my mom uses a walker. I was shocked that there was a $25.00 charge for an amputee to use the valet. (At casino Niagara and Seneca Niagara there is no charge for handicapped people) Also when I went to the rewards desk was shocked that they were not giving anything for Mother's day unless you were a Seven Seas or Diamond member. I found the casino not too easy to push my husband around. The carpet I know is plush to look nice but it is challenging for handicapped people. Also when we arrived at 4 pm the one handicapped stall in the washroom on the top floor by the poker room was out of order and six hours later when my husband needed to vomit I rushed him to the bathroom not realizing it was the same washroom and the handicapped stall was still broken after 6 hours. As a casino that has alot of handicapped people you have to do better. When your remodel try having a low pile carpet or at least tile in the walkways. Also your comps are not very good. We spent $1600.00 and couldn't get a dinner comp. Years ago when you came here the comps were much better for normal everyday people like me that aren't high rollers.

Beautiful Hotel. The sleep was great with a very comfortable King Sized Bed and excellent blackout curtains. The one issue I had was our second night was concert night (we didn’t go) and we had no idea how long the lines to eat were going to be! We waited over and hour to get into Spago to sit at bar. There were lines for Johnny Rockets, Legend’s sports bar, and even Tim’s. They need to get more places to eat or a single bar to get snacks. Great customer service though and granted us a late check out. Be prepared to walk a lot and have change or singles to tip the vallet and the bell hop.
